Pyhon 3 Assignment Write a program to calculate the cost per cubic foot to completely fill (to the top!) an above ground, round pool. Assume that the height of the pool is four feet. Accept from the user the diameter of the pool and the total cost of the water. Print the cost of the water per cubic foot. (Do not use data structures, functions, or Python statements we have not covered in class.) Test Case: Diameter 12 and water cost 500 --1.105 Use the following formula: 2 Volume of a cylinder: V- h

Explanation / Answer

# Program to calculate the volume of the pool and cost of water per cubic foot given the total cost of water

PI = 3.14
diameter = float(input('Please Enter the diameter of pool: '))
height = 4 # height of pool = 4 feet
watercost = float(input(' Please Enter the water cost: '))

Volume = PI * diameter/2 * diameter/2 * height  

print(" The Volume of a Pool = %.3f" %Volume)
cost = float((watercost/Volume ))
print(" Cost of water per cubic foot = %.3f" %cost)
